Mom of 2 Mistook Her Ovarian Cancer Symptoms for Sinus Infection: ‘The Whole World Just Stood Still’ 

NEED TO KNOW

  • Jessica Gilbert, 42, assumed her fever and “stuffy head” were signs of a sinus infection
  • When tests came back negative for COVID-19, the flu and RSV, she asked the doctor if it was a sinus infection or low iron
  • Instead, her ER physician diagnosed her with stage 3 ovarian cancer

An Ohio mother of two mistook her ovarian cancer symptoms for those of a sinus infection.

Jessica Gilbert, a 42-year-old wife and mom, felt “off” before a family trip to Walt Disney World in January.

“I woke up with a fever, and I thought it was a sinus infection because I had a stuffy head all week,” Gilbert told ABC News. “I decided to go to my [primary care] doctor to get COVID, flu, [and] RSV tests, and they all came back negative.”

After the negative test results, Gilbert presumed her symptoms reflected a potential sinus infection or low iron levels. However, once she explained the symptoms, an ER doctor suggested they run tests for ovarian cancer.

“The whole world just stood still,” Gilbert told the outlet. “I was just totally shocked. [I had] no family history. I didn’t know any of the signs for ovarian cancer. I just didn’t know anything about it at all.”

Doctors at UC Medical Center went on to diagnose her with stage 3 ovarian cancer, local NBC affiliate WLWT 5 reports.

“I didn’t really know the symptoms for ovarian cancer. And since I don’t have family history, I just really didn’t think anything of it,” Gilbert told WLWT. She has since had a full hysterectomy and started chemotherapy.

Gilbert cited her longtime support for the Cincinnati Bengals as one of her comforts as she undergoes treatment. “I feel like the Bengals are always like kind of considered the underdog. And Joe Burrow, he said, ‘Why not us?’ And that really stuck with me,” Gilbert told the local news station.

Gilbert’s brother, Shawn Gilbert, started a GoFundMe to support the financial and emotional costs of his sister’s cancer treatment journey.

“My dear sister, Jessica Gilbert, a loving mother to 6-year-old Harry and 10-year-old Mia, is facing a tough and unexpected fight,” Shawn wrote in the description.

“We are reaching out to you, our community to rally together and provide Jessica with the financial support she needs to get the best possible care and to ease the burden on her family during this challenging time,” Shawn continued.

As of publication, the fundraiser has raised $25,200 of their $40,000 goal.
